System Logs werden nicht Angezeigt

  • Hallo zusammen.


    Am Wochenende habe Ich meine Homebridge mal umgestellt. Einzelne Instanzen bzw. Service angelegt und von init.d auf Systemd umgestellt.


    Bei versuch mir nun die log dasein anzeigen lassen bekomme ich keine angezeigt.

    Hat jemand die Lösung was nicht passen könnte?


    Code
    pi@raspberrypi:~ $ sudo journalctl -f -au homebridge*
    Failed to add match 'homebridge.log': Invalid argument
    pi@raspberrypi:~ $ sudo rm /etc/default/homebridge-harmony.service
    pi@raspberrypi:~ $ sudo journalctl -f -au homebridge-people
    -- Logs begin at Thu 2016-11-03 18:16:43 CET. --
    ^X^C
    pi@raspberrypi:~ $ sudo journalctl -f -au homebridge-fritz-platform
    -- Logs begin at Thu 2016-11-03 18:16:43 CET. --
  • Keiner im Forum eine Idee?

  • Versuche mal:


    sudo journalctl -f -u homebridge*



    Also einfach das „a“ bei -u weglassen??



    Sent from my iPhone using Community

  • Danke Kohle_81

    Klappt leider auch nicht.

    Code
    pi@raspberrypi:~ $ sudo journalctl -f -u homebridge*
    Failed to add match 'homebridge.log': Das Argument ist ungültig
  • Dann bin ich leider raus, kenn mich da nur oberflächlich aus.....


    Kannst du die gespeicherte Logdatei aufrufen?


    sudo cat /var/log/syslog



    Sent from my iPhone using Community

  • Ja geht.

  • Eventuell muss da manuell was erstellt werden, da muss ich aber dann an unsere Experten hier im Forum überleiten..... vielleicht meldet sich noch jemand dazu, ist halt noch Urlaubszeit



    Sent from my iPhone using Community

  • Das Journalctl kann nur das log von einem Dienst anzeigen.

    Code
     sudo journalctl -fau homebridge

    der Status kann von mehreren angezeigt werden

    Code
    sudo systemctl status homebridge*

    aber alle Dienste sollten im syslog erscheinen

    Code
    sudo tail -f /var/log/syslog

    :)

  • Code
    sudo systemctl status homebridge*
    Code
    pi@raspberrypi:~ $ sudo systemctl status homebridge*
    Unit homebridge.err.service could not be found.
    Unit homebridge.log.service could not be found.
  • Liegt es an meiner  /etc/init.d/homebridge ?


  • Oh Gott, =O

    Du benutzt ja noch initd zum Starten, das sind nicht die Dienste

    die loggen in homebridge.log und homebridge.err in /var/log


    hier musst Du mit:

    /etc/init.d/homebridge status schauen

    und mit

    tail -f /var/log/homebridge.log

    tail -f /var/log/homebridge.lerr


    evtl. sudo davor

    :)

  • Ich habe doch umgestellt. Habe mehrere Instanzen angelegt und den Umzug von init.d aus systemd gemacht.

  • Warum postest Du dann das initd script?

    Dachte, hängt damit zusammen.